People Score in 01468, Templeton, Massachusetts

The People Score for the Breast Cancer Score in 01468, Templeton, Massachusetts is 57 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 98.42 percent of the residents in 01468 has some form of health insurance. 35.61 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 73.14 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 01468 would have to travel an average of 4.28 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Heywood Hospital. In a 20-mile radius, there are 508 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 01468, Templeton, Massachusetts.
